在当今的互联网世界中,我们每天都要使用各种各样的服务——从社交媒体到在线购物,从娱乐服务到金融服务。这些服务的背后是复杂的系统管理,需要确保数据的安全性和用户的身份认证。在这其中,“bitget token”是一个重要的概念,它是对个人用户账户的一个数字签名,用以确认用户的身份和权限,保障个人信息安全的同时,也方便了系统的自动化处理。

什么是bitget token?

Bitget token,全称为BITGET平台的令牌验证机制,是一种基于JWT(JSON Web Tokens)的认证和授权机制。它是一个字符串,通常由三部分组成:头部信息、数据主体和签名哈希。头部包含了令牌的基本信息和生命周期信息,数据主体则是存储在令牌中的用户信息或者权限指令,而签名则是通过HMAC算法对头部和数据主体的合并结果进行加密后的值。这个签名用于验证整个令牌在传输过程中是否被篡改过。

为什么需要bitget token?

1. 用户身份验证:Bitget token可以帮助系统快速准确地识别一个请求的发起者,确保只有已注册的用户才能访问某些受保护的服务或资源。

2. 安全控制:令牌包含的权限信息可以精确控制用户的操作范围,防止未授权的操作和数据泄露风险。

3. 自动处理流程:在分布式系统中,token化的用户身份能够减少每次请求时都需要进行完整认证流程的需要,从而提高了系统的效率和响应速度。

4. 跨域访问:通过令牌交换,不同域名或服务的系统可以共享用户的认证状态,实现无缝的访问和管理体验。

5. 防篡改保护:签名部分保证了整个token在传输过程中的完整性,确保了用户信息的安全性。

bitget token的获取和使用过程

用户在进行bitget平台的登录后,系统会生成一个token并发送回用户的浏览器(或移动设备)存储起来。之后每次需要访问平台上的服务时,该token都会随请求一起被发送给服务器。服务器验证token的真实性后,就会根据token中包含的信息来确定用户是否有权进行当前的操作。

使用过程中,需要注意的是:

有效期:Token通常是有时间限制的,一旦过期就需要用户重新登录获取新的token。

安全性:由于token直接关联用户的操作权限和账户信息,所以应确保token的安全存储和使用。不应当在URL中直接展示或通过不安全的渠道传输。

刷新机制:当token失效后,需要使用refresh token来换取新的token继续进行交互。

安全措施和最佳实践

为了确保bitget token的使用安全性,平台提供商和开发者应当遵循以下安全措施和最佳实践:

1. 严格的加密算法:使用HMAC SHA-256等高级加密算法保证令牌的安全性和防篡改能力。

2. 短时间限制:为了减少长时间持有个体token的风险,应设置较短的过期时间。

3. 避免敏感信息的泄露:不要将token包含在公共的日志或配置文件中。

4. 多因素认证:对于重要操作和资源,可以使用令牌验证配合其他身份验证方法(如密码、手机短信验证码等)来增加安全性。

5. 定期审核与更新:定期检查系统的安全漏洞,及时更新和修复可能存在的风险点。

bitget token作为一种强大的身份认证和授权机制,在确保用户信息安全的同时,也极大地简化了用户的操作流程,提高了系统的处理效率和响应速度。随着互联网应用的不断扩展和新技术的不断出现,bitget token的应用范围也会得到更广泛的发展和应用。